A case of disturbed vertical gaze
Heidi Brown1, Harry E Willshaw
1Birmingham and Midlands Eye Centre, Birmingham, UK.
Summary
This study presents a rare case of idiopathic vertical ocular motor apraxia (OMA) in a 10-month-old boy. Initial MRI was normal, but later review revealed cerebellar and thalamic pathology affecting vertical eye movements.

Background:
- Vertical ocular motor apraxia (OMA) is a rare condition affecting eye movement control.
- Idiopathic OMA, without a known cause, is exceptionally uncommon, particularly in infants.
Observation:
- A 10-month-old boy presented with symptoms suggestive of vertical OMA.
- Optokinetic testing confirmed a specific deficit: the absence of downward saccades.
Findings:
- This represents the first reported case of idiopathic vertical OMA.
- Re-evaluation of the initial MRI revealed previously unnoticed pathology in the cerebellum and thalamus.
- These brain regions are critical for the control of vertical eye movements.
Implications:
- This case expands the understanding of OMA's potential causes and presentations.
- Highlights the importance of detailed neuroimaging review in diagnosing rare pediatric neurological disorders.
- Suggests that cerebellar and thalamic abnormalities can manifest as idiopathic vertical OMA.
